used ball mill  working principle

this ball mill is horizontal type and tubular running device, has two warehouses. this machine is grid type and its outside runs along gear. the material enters spirally and evenly the first warehouse of the milling machine along the input material hollow axis by input material device. in this warehouse , there is a ladder scaleboard or ripple scaleboard, and different specification steel balls are installed on the scaleboard, when the barrel body rotates and then produces centrifugal force ,at this time , the steel ball is carried tosome height and falls to make the material grinding and striking. after grinded coarsely in the first warehouse, the material then enters into the second warehousefor regrinding with the steel ball and scaleboard. in the end, the powder is discharged by output material board andthe end products are completed.

used ball mill opeartion

ball mill repair and maintenance are crucial for assuring manufacture efficiency. if not maintained properly, ball mill run-time will be reduced causing substantial economic losses.
1. the operators must be qualified with the required technical knowledge, received technical training and fully understand the operating principle, regulations of the ball mill.
2. the operators should follow the operate principle and lubricate the requirement parts marked in lubrication picture. untreated waste oil may not be used and keep lubrication points clean.
3. pay attention to check the temperature of bearing not to exceed 60 and make sure every bolt not loose, no abnormal sound, uniform mining feed, steady water feed, normal current and voltage of motor.
4. to keep surroundings clean where the ball mill run. every party should be clean unless it’s running.
